Abstract

Investigation of neutrino spin oscillation in the gravitational fields of black holes (BHs) is one of the interesting topics in neutrino physics. On the other hand, in recent years, many studies have been devoted to the exploration of different physical phenomena in higher dimensions. Non-commutative geometry has also been focus of researchers in recent years to explore the structure of space-time more deeply and accurately. In this work, the neutrino spin oscillation in the non-commutative higher dimensional gravitational fields of Schwarzschild and Reissner Nordstrom metrics is studied. The effects of noncommutativity of space are calculated and its role in different dimensions is discussed. Considering the fact that in the non-commutative space, for certain values of eta, no event horizon exists and consequently, there will be no BH, some upper bounds for the non-commutative parameter are obtained.
